Output 96504323ce750f3eccaf04d2c08abde65d3bbc9e713eb25fa159a78d13535172:15

value
8134880848
script pubkey
OP_0 OP_PUSHBYTES_32 c1cc6ea230ca8d654920a581ceb574680a9e813af60ddeecc9462ee524e9bd07
address
bc1qc8xxag3se2xk2jfq5kquadt5dq9faqf67cxaamxfgchw2f8fh5rsrwrgxq
transaction
96504323ce750f3eccaf04d2c08abde65d3bbc9e713eb25fa159a78d13535172
spent
true